Description

What kind of wine it is

Rolly Gassmann Alsace Gewurztraminer is an aromatic still white wine with a pale straw yellow colour, faithfully expressing the character of the Gewurztraminer grape. The bouquet is distinctly spicy, featuring clear aromas of ginger, cinnamon and fragrant orange zest. On the palate, it boasts an opulent structure, maintaining excellent balance thanks to the freshness imparted by hints of grapefruit. This white wine is ideally suited to spicy Asian cuisine, and also pairs perfectly with mature cheeses and delicate dishes based on poultry or lean fish.

Where it comes from

The grapes are sourced from the areas of Rorschwihr and Bergheim, in the heart of Alsace. This region benefits from the protection of the Vosges mountain range, making it one of the driest areas in France. The hot summers favour perfect ripening of the grapes, while the remarkable complexity of the soils, rich in limestone, marl and clay with sandy and granitic veins, defines the structure of the wine. In this privileged context, Rolly Gassmann has been cultivating the land since 1611, following strict organic and sustainable practices.

How it is produced

After meticulous manual selection at full ripeness, the grapes undergo gentle pressing. Fermentation takes place in individual tanks thanks to the action of indigenous yeasts, which are essential for preserving the fruit's identity. The use of separate vinification for each individual vineyard allows the specific characteristics of each plot to be fully expressed. This is followed by a short rest of a few months and a long maturation of around two years before release, a key stage for harmonising and enhancing the final flavour profile.

Producer
Rolly Gassmann
From this winery
  • Start up year: 1611
  • Bottles produced: 300.000
  • Hectares: 50
Rolly Gassmann is based in the small village of Rorschwirhr, in the Northernmost part of the Upper Rhine Department in Alsace. The property consists of about 50 hectares of vineyards, divided between the municipalties of Rorschwirhr and Bergheim, allows for a unique variety of soils: clay, sand, limestone and granite alternate in this area, creating wines with a strong and decisive character.

The winery is now run by Marie-Thérèse, Louis and their son Pierre Gassmann. The production is about 300,000 bottles per year, only 20% of which are destined for export outside France. The wines are powerful, precise, played on the difficult ridge of a vibrant acidity and balanced sweetness: Pinot Gris, Riesling and Gewurztraminer by Rolly-Gassmann give pure enjoyment especially to those who have the patience to wait for the legendary ability to evolve in the bottle.
